Story summary
- A verdict is pending in the defamation case between Linda Reynolds and Brittany Higgins after a five-week trial.
- Reynolds alleges Higgins violated a non-disparagement clause from a 2021 settlement through social media posts.
- Higgins did not testify; her lawyer argued her intent was to raise awareness of her alleged assault.
- Both parties accused each other of media harassment related to allegations against Higgins' former boss, Bruce Lehrmann.
- Reynolds seeks significant damages and a permanent injunction against future disparaging remarks from Higgins.
